From Pretoria to North American Technology Circles

Elon Reeve Musk was born on June 28, 1971, in Pretoria, South Africa. He turned 55 in June 2026. He left South Africa for Canada as a teenager, studied at Queen’s University in Ontario, and later transferred to the University of Pennsylvania. His years in Canada and the United States placed him closer to the emerging software and venture-capital industries that would shape his career.

That geographic journey matters to his image. Musk did not develop the polished wardrobe of someone trained inside finance, law, or luxury retail. His early identity was built around computing, physics, science fiction, and entrepreneurial risk. Clothing was secondary to the project.

Physics, Economics and an Early Taste for Large Problems

Musk earned degrees associated with physics and business at the University of Pennsylvania. Tesla’s corporate biography lists a physics degree and a business degree from the Wharton School. He briefly entered a graduate program at Stanford but left before completing it as commercial opportunities around the internet expanded.

The Builder Identity Behind His Public Persona

Musk’s reputation grew through companies associated with physical products and difficult engineering targets. He co-founded Zip2, became involved in the payment company that developed into PayPal, founded SpaceX, and joined Tesla during its early years before becoming chief executive in 2008. Tesla also identifies him with Neuralink and The Boring Company.

His Marriages to Justine Wilson and Talulah Riley

Musk married Canadian author Justine Wilson in 2000. They divorced in 2008. He later married British actor Talulah Riley in 2010, divorced her, remarried her, and finalized their second divorce in 2016. His later relationship with musician Grimes became public when they attended the 2018 Met Gala together.

Those relationships occasionally changed how he was presented visually. The Met Gala appearance with Grimes was among his most deliberately styled red-carpet moments. He wore a white dinner jacket and a white shirt with a dark clerical-style collar detail, while her darker, theatrical clothing created a sharp visual contrast.

The outfit was memorable because it responded to the event rather than repeating standard business dress. It also showed that Musk can engage with fashion when a setting rewards experimentation. His daily wardrobe, however, returned quickly to simpler executive and casual forms.

From Zip2 and PayPal to High-Risk Industrial Ventures

Musk’s first major commercial success came through Zip2, a software company founded during the early internet period. After its sale, he became involved in X.com, which developed through a merger into the company known as PayPal. PayPal was later acquired by eBay.

These exits gave him the capital to pursue projects with far greater manufacturing risk. Rather than remaining a software investor, he directed money toward launch systems, electric cars, energy products, and other physical technologies.

His clothing slowly changed with that transition. Early photographs often show loose business shirts and ordinary late-1990s office wear. As his companies became larger, dark suits and leather jackets began carrying more of the public message. They helped turn a software entrepreneur into a recognizable industrial figure. Why His Net Worth Can Change So Quickly

Real-time wealth trackers have repeatedly ranked Musk among the world’s richest people. On July 16, 2026, Inc., citing the Bloomberg Billionaires Index, reported an estimate slightly above $850 billion. Forbes also maintains a live profile, but such figures can change sharply as the estimated values of Tesla, SpaceX, and other holdings move.

That figure is not cash in a bank account. It is an estimate based largely on company ownership, private-company valuations, stock prices, debt, and other financial assumptions. A market move can add or remove billions on paper without a comparable change in daily spending.

The California Property Sell-Off and Texas Downsizing

Architectural Digest reported that Musk sold a group of high-value California properties after stating that he intended to reduce his possessions. These included homes in the Los Angeles area and a large property near San Francisco. The publication also discussed reports that his main Texas residence was far smaller and more modest than the houses he had sold.

Claims that he lived inside a specific prefabricated Boxabl unit were never fully confirmed. Walter Isaacson’s reporting instead showed a simple two-bedroom house near SpaceX operations in South Texas. The distinction matters because repeated online stories can turn an uncertain detail into an accepted fact.

The Cars Most Closely Linked to Musk’s Story

Musk’s vehicle history includes several well-documented machines. After the success of Zip2, he bought a McLaren F1 and appeared with it in a widely circulated television segment. He later sold the car after it was damaged in an accident. He also purchased the Lotus Esprit submarine prop used in the James Bond film The Spy Who Loved Me.

The Lotus purchase is especially consistent with his taste. It combines engineering, cinema, futurism, and a machine that appears capable of transformation. That is more aligned with his image than a conventional collection of polished luxury sedans.

Tesla vehicles naturally dominate later accounts of his driving. Architectural Digest cited a public post in which he described using Tesla models for different situations. Ownership and daily use can change, however, so long inventories of cars attributed to him should be approached with care.

Why Tailored Jackets Work Better Than Standard Office Suits

Musk often looks strongest in dark single-breasted jackets with peak lapels, a white shirt, and restrained accessories. Peak lapels create upward movement and widen the chest, which suits his broad upper body. A jacket with enough length also reduces the visual weight around the waist.

He frequently skips a tie outside formal government or ceremonial settings. The open collar makes a suit feel closer to technology leadership than banking. It also keeps the outfit from appearing too rehearsed. When the shirt collar sits neatly and the jacket has enough room, this formula is effective.

Problems appear when the coat is too tight. Pulling around the button creates an X-shaped crease, while short sleeves expose too much shirt cuff. Men following his approach should choose a jacket that closes without strain. Tailoring should create authority through clean lines, not through compression.

The Leather Flight Jacket as a Masculine Costume

At the 2023 New York Times DealBook event, Musk wore a dark leather flight jacket with a large fur-lined collar. The Washington Post read the look as a deliberate costume of rugged, mid-century masculinity. It referenced pilots, explorers, adventurers, and cinematic outsiders more than contemporary Silicon Valley businesswear.

The garment was powerful because it occupied so much visual space. The broad collar framed his face, the dark leather added weight, and the aviation reference connected naturally with SpaceX. Yet it was also theatrical. Most men would look overdressed wearing a heavy flight jacket during an indoor interview.

A simpler bomber or leather zip jacket offers a more practical interpretation. Keep the collar smaller, avoid excessive hardware, and wear it with a plain knit or open-neck shirt. The goal is to borrow the confidence of the silhouette without turning everyday clothing into a costume.

Casual Clothes and the Power of Not Appearing Styled

GQ has noted that Musk’s casual wardrobe often seems indifferent to fashion. He has appeared in plain T-shirts, jeans, basic sneakers, and simple outerwear even at events where a more managed look might be expected. The publication contrasted this inconsistency with technology leaders whose daily uniforms are carefully controlled.

That apparent lack of styling can itself become influential. It suggests that the wearer is too occupied with larger matters to spend time coordinating clothing. The message is persuasive because it matches the popular image of the overworked founder.

Still, indifference is risky. A basic T-shirt only looks intentional when it fits well at the shoulders and falls cleanly over the body. Dark jeans should avoid heavy stacking, and sneakers should appear maintained. The most transferable part of Musk’s casual style is simplicity, not neglect.

The Short, Textured Hairstyle Associated With His Image

His current hairstyle usually keeps the sides relatively tidy while leaving more length through the top. The front is lifted or directed sideways, giving the face more height. This works well with his rounded facial contours because it draws the eye upward instead of adding width near the cheeks.

The style also survives movement. Musk often appears outdoors, near machinery, or in crowded media situations. Hair that remains slightly flexible looks more natural in those settings than a rigid, highly lacquered finish.

A similar result requires a conservative taper rather than an aggressive skin fade. The top should retain enough length to move with a brush or fingers. A barber can shape the sides so they sit close without making the haircut look disconnected from the wearer’s age or professional role.

Clean-Shaven Formality Versus Light Stubble

Musk has alternated between a clean-shaven face and short, uneven stubble. The clean-shaven version works best with formal suits because it creates a sharper separation between the white shirt, dark lapels, and face. It also makes his appearance read as more traditional during official meetings.

Stubble changes the message. Paired with a leather jacket or casual black clothing, it reinforces the explorer or industrial-founder image. It can also add definition around a softer jawline, although the edges need enough control to avoid looking accidental.

Men using this approach should match facial hair to the outfit. A suit with imperfect stubble may look unfinished, while the same stubble can suit a bomber jacket. Keeping the neckline clean and trimming stray growth around the mouth makes the difference between relaxed grooming and simple inattention.

Publicly Discussed Weight Changes and Medication

In December 2024, Musk publicly referred to using Mounjaro after previously discussing other GLP-1 medications. Axios and People reported his comments after he posted a photograph showing a slimmer appearance. These are prescription drugs with medical risks and eligibility requirements, so his experience should not be treated as a recommendation for casual use.

The visible change affected his clothing. Jackets sat more cleanly around the middle in some later appearances, while his face appeared narrower. A leaner outline can make structured suits look sharper, but fit remains necessary. Weight loss does not correct sleeve length, shoulder balance, or trouser shape.

Anyone considering prescription weight treatment should speak with a qualified healthcare professional. Celebrity use provides no information about another person’s medical history, dosage, side effects, or suitability.
